About Green Park Elementary School

Green Park Elementary School operates as a moderately sized elementary-level community in WALLA WALLA, Washington, one of the schools within Walla Walla Public Schools. Current enrollment sits at 526 students spanning grades K through 5. Compared to the state average of about 380 students per school, that is 38% bigger than typical.

Green Park Elementary School is one of 16 schools operated by Walla Walla Public Schools, a district that caters to 5,410 students overall.

On the student-mix side, Green Park Elementary School lists that Hispanic students make up the majority at 56%. Other groups include 38% White, 3% multiracial. That is meaningfully more Hispanic than the county at large, where the share is closer to 24%.

In terms of school funding signals, Staff filings list 34 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 15.3:1 students per teacher. The state averages around 17.3: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ical. An estimated 74%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. Set against Walla Walla County (around 63%), the school's rate is meaningfully above typical.

On a residual basis (actual vs predicted given the student mix), Green Park Elementary School t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 30.3%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 33.0%.

In the broader community, Walla Walla County reports that the typical household earns roughly $74,202 per year, 30%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and roughly 9%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Green Park Elementary School is one of 33 public schools in Walla Walla County (combined enrollment of about 8,516 students).

Nearest neighbor: Walla Walla Online, around 0.7 miles off.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Green Park Elementary School.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ts Green Park Elementary School at 4th of 4; the average score across the group is 38.8%.

Geographically, the school is in a metropolitan area.

Looking at the recent track record.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at Green Park Elementary School has expanded 24%, going from 425 students in 2018 to 526 in 2025. The Hispanic share of enrollment edged up from 40% to 56% over that span.
